Just wanted to say a quick g'day and introduce myself.

I am one of those old gamers (got started in wargaming as a young lad in 1982) who has thrown away a fortune to those big games companies over the years. Back in the 80's most games (fantasy based especially) were really developing and exploring new frontiers and the minature sculpting went ahead in leaps and bounds. Now the pattern seems to be  producing fantasy miniatures that are bigger and more expensive each month with a bag of new rules designed to sell miniatures rather than for game balance.

It was so refreshing to find this game site where the main focus seems to be about creativity and originality with enough fluff to keep the old RPG'er in me happy. Hoping to get my game club interested since we are currently taking a break from the more commercial stuff and trying all sorts of alternative games.

I immediately got sucked in and sent off an order for a bag full of miniatures from HF straight away  Smiley Now I just need to wait for the airmail to bring me my goodies so I can get painting...its a long way from the UK to here.

I'm more of a painter and modeller than a gamer (can't wait to order one of those Belan and use my airbrush on it) so I hope you guys won't mind me converting the stuff I get (thinking the knights as they are my favourites atm). From reading the forum it seems the Fubarnii clans are a diverse lot.

Anyway, looking forward to discussing stuff in the future as things seem quite friendly around here. BTW I don't know why, but reading about all the background made me want to watch the Dark Crystal again lol.
